Spamalot Rolls Out the Red Carpet for Claymates

071017clayaiken.jpg
Clay Aiken by Stephen Lovekin/WireImage.com
Following in the footsteps of American Idol alumna Fantasia, Tamyra Gray and Diana DeGarmo, Clay Aiken is Broadway-bound. On Jan. 18, 2008, he'll appear for the first time in Monty Python's Spamalot as Sir Robin the Chicken-Hearted. For those unfamiliar with the character, lily-livered Sir Robin "nearly fought the dragon of Angnor" and "nearly stood up to the vicious chicken of Bristol," thus making him the perfect counterpart for Aiken, who "nearly beat Ruben Studdard." — Ben Katner
